Visualizzazione dei risultati da 1 a 8 su 8

Discussione: Php su postgress

  1. #1
    Utente di HTML.it L'avatar di Kneos
    Registrato dal
    Aug 2002
    Messaggi
    128

    Php su postgress

    Salve a tutto il forum, io solitamente uso php/MySql per creare script con DB ma mi hanno chiesto di fare un sito su un dominio che usa php/Postgres.
    Ora non credo ci siano problemi per le funzioni, i SELECT, UPDATE ecc ecc sono uguali per tutti i dbms e le funzioni cambiano solo nel nome (invece di mysql_fetch_array c'è pg_fetch_array con le loro sintassi),
    correggetemi se sbaglio.......

    Il problema che vi sottopongo e la struttuta del db, cioe ad esempio i tipi dei dati nel db (int, varchar ecc) sono uguali, posso fare le stesse coses che faccio con mysql?

    Ad esempio a me serve che il campo pippo, chiave della tabella, sia autoincrementante, è possibile farlo anche in postgress?
    Esiste un tool di amministrazione come PhpMyadmin per postgres in cui posso smanettare e importare una struttura sql? (file di testo preparati ad hoc per ricostruire la struttura e i dati nel db)

    Grazie a tutti in amticipo.

  2. #2
    Utente bannato
    Registrato dal
    Dec 2003
    Messaggi
    721
    esiste una cosa simile al phpmyadmin si chiama phppgadmin

    oppure c'è un programma che si chima pgadmin che ti permette di gestire il db da remoto.

  3. #3
    Utente di HTML.it L'avatar di Kneos
    Registrato dal
    Aug 2002
    Messaggi
    128
    Che mi dite riguardo le differenze sulla struttura del db? Quella questione dell campo autoincrementante, ne sapete nulla???

    Grazie

  4. #4
    per favore NIENTE PVT TECNICI da sconosciuti

  5. #5
    Utente di HTML.it L'avatar di Kneos
    Registrato dal
    Aug 2002
    Messaggi
    128
    Ottimo ho trovato quello che cercavo!!!!

  6. #6
    Utente di HTML.it L'avatar di Kneos
    Registrato dal
    Aug 2002
    Messaggi
    128
    Solo un ultima cosa, e davvero come penso rigurdo le funzioni postgres o mysql? Intendo dire che mysql_query, mysql_fetch_array e cosi via vengono semplicemente sostituite con le corrispondenti postgres (pg_query, pg_fetch_array ecc ecc) nel codice php?
    Nulla di piu???

    Grazie ancora

  7. #7
    Originariamente inviato da Kneos
    Solo un ultima cosa, e davvero come penso rigurdo le funzioni postgres o mysql? Intendo dire che mysql_query, mysql_fetch_array e cosi via vengono semplicemente sostituite con le corrispondenti postgres (pg_query, pg_fetch_array ecc ecc) nel codice php?
    Nulla di piu???

    Grazie ancora
    Se per "sostituire" intendi il loro funzionamento interno, di sicuro no.
    Se invece ti riferisci alla somiglianza...sì e no.
    Un database è un database quindi le funzioni si assomigliano tra loro, ma le diverse API si distinguono per meglio rispecchiare le funzionalità dei vari database....non che questo sia necessariamente un bene
    http://freephp.html.it/articoli/view...olo.asp?id=127
    per favore NIENTE PVT TECNICI da sconosciuti

  8. #8
    Originariamente inviato da Kneos
    Solo un ultima cosa, e davvero come penso rigurdo le funzioni postgres o mysql? Intendo dire che mysql_query, mysql_fetch_array e cosi via vengono semplicemente sostituite con le corrispondenti postgres (pg_query, pg_fetch_array ecc ecc) nel codice php?
    Nulla di piu???
    Si e no, come diceva Fabio.

    Per un uso base, come quello descritto nell'articolo, puoi anche utilizzare quelle funzioni che le due API "hanno in comune", ma tieni presente che ogni API riflette la specificità di ciascun DBMS (cosa testimoniata dal fatto, tra l'altro, che l'API per Postgre ha parecchie funzioni che non hanno una corrispondenza in quella per MySql) e di questo non puoi non tener conto.
    Addio Aldo, amico mio... [03/12/70 - 16/08/03]

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.